Sue Cischke's retires from Ford Motor

 

Sue Cischke has retired from her career at Ford Motor and she'll be leaving a gaping hole in the ranks of women executives at the Detroit automakers, as the Forbes article states.

This is an area where we need CEOs to fill the pipeline with women... we need a higher representation of women on their senior leadership teams. When will there be a female CEO? Or how about a contender to become CEO at the very least? It starts at the top!
